Telegram Перейти

Sim800l Proteus Library Top ((hot))

Sim800l Proteus Library Top ((hot))

Simulating the Go to product viewer dialog for this item. in Proteus allows developers to test cellular functionality like SMS and AT commands without needing physical hardware. Because Proteus does not include a native

  1. Locate your Proteus Installation Folder:

    void setup() Serial.begin(9600); sim800l.begin(9600); delay(5000); // Wait for module to boot sim800l proteus library top

    Features of Sim800L Proteus Library

    • GSM Module Simulation: The library simulates the behavior of the Sim800L GSM module, allowing users to test SMS, voice, and data communication.
    • AT Command Support: The library supports AT commands, which are used to control the GSM module.
    • Serial Communication: The library provides a serial interface to communicate with the GSM module.

    Practical benefits for developers and educators

    • Faster iteration: simulate AT-command flows and debug firmware without waiting for physical hardware to arrive.
    • Safer testing: reproduce edge cases (network outages, low signal) that are hard to force on live networks.
    • Cost savings: avoid repeated SMS/call charges during testing, and reduce wear on physical modules.
    • Teaching tool: students can learn cellular protocols and AT command sequences in a controlled environment, seeing both serial interaction and circuit-level effects (e.g., brownouts).
    • Design validation: uncover power-supply issues early by observing the module’s simulated current spikes and voltage sag under varying loads.
    • Correct power supply simulation (4.0V – 4.4V net).
    • Level shifting (5V to 2.8V) simulation using voltage regulators.
    • A virtual terminal pre-connected to debug UART.

    Download the Files: Usually, you will receive a ZIP file containing two main files: SIM800L.LIB and SIM800L.IDX. Locate Proteus Library Folder: Simulating the Go to product viewer dialog for this item